Accessing WebTrac/RecTrac: Spontaneous 502 IIS Error
RecTrac 3.1.10.18.00
Table of Contents
Problem
We have recently applied no system or software changes. Our attempts to access WebTrac or RecTrac (Live or Demo) yield a spontaneous error. We verified through OpenEdge Progress that all WebSpeed Agents and the database are running properly.
Error Message
502 Web server received an invalid response while acting as a gateway or proxy server
Solution
In this case, the 502 Error results from the RecTrac.lg file found at <x>:\VSI3\RecTrac\Data\LIVE or <x>:\VSI3\RecTrac\Data\DEMO, depending on database, exceeding 4.2 GB. To delete, turn off the RecTrac database. Once turned off, you can safely delete the RecTrac.lg (which will recreate itself once turned back on).
Steps For Solution
- Log in to OpenEdge Explorer.
- Turn off all "Live" or "Demo" (depending on database) AppServers and WebSpeeds.
- Turn off your "Live or "Demo" Database.
- Go to <x>:\VSI3\RecTrac\Data\LIVE
- Or <x>:\VSI3\RecTrac\Data\DEMO if the demo database is producing the error message
- Delete the RecTrac.lg.
- Log back in to OpenEdge Explorer.
- Turn on the Database.
- Turn on the AppServers and WebSpeeds.
You should now be able to access WebTrac and RecTrac successfully.
